Support an optional default template for Citoid extension to support upstream changes to itemTypes (as well as make it easier to configure if a wiki only has one citation template)
Description
Details
| Subject | Repo | Branch | Lines +/- | |
|---|---|---|---|---|
| Support a default template | mediawiki/extensions/Citoid | master | +6 -4 |
| Status | Subtype | Assigned | Task | ||
|---|---|---|---|---|---|
| Resolved | BUG REPORT | Pppery | T347823 Citoid extension for requests incorrectly states it was not possible to create a citation | ||
| Resolved | Mvolz | T384709 Support default template for Citoid Extension |
Event Timeline
Change #1148303 had a related patch set uploaded (by Mvolz; author: Mvolz):
[mediawiki/extensions/Citoid@master] Support a default template
Change #1148303 merged by jenkins-bot:
[mediawiki/extensions/Citoid@master] Support a default template
For Tech News, what wording would you suggest as the entry's content? You can either draft an entry here, or if you're confident on what it should say add it directly to the next draft.
Timing-wise, based on the merged-patch above I assume this should go in the upcoming edition (frozen for translations in ~18 hours, and delivered on Monday), but if that's incorrect please share a rough time-estimate for which week it should be announced. Thanks!
Something like -
Configuring automatic citations for your wiki has been simplified as you can now set a default template to use with the "_default" key (example diff). You can still set templates for individual item types as they will be preferred to the default template. This will also future proof existing configurations when [[ T347823 | new item types ]] are added.
There is no rush on getting this out. Maybe wait til the next week in case there are unexpected issues.